The Importance of Authenticity

The first and foremost principle in managing a celebrity’s social media presence is authenticity. Fans and followers are drawn to celebrities who are genuine and relatable. Authenticity creates a bond of trust and loyalty between the celebrity and their audience. It involves being true to one’s personality, values, and beliefs while sharing content.

This means that a celebrity’s social media posts should reflect their real-life persona and not just a carefully curated image. Being authentic also means acknowledging mistakes and being transparent with followers, which can significantly enhance the relatability factor.

Crafting a Unique Voice

A unique and consistent voice is essential for celebrities to stand out on social media. This voice becomes a part of their brand identity, making them easily recognizable to their audience. It involves the way they communicate, the language they use, and the overall tone of their social media presence.

Whether it’s humorous, inspirational, or activist, this voice should align with the celebrity’s personality and public image. Consistency in this voice across various platforms ensures that the audience receives a coherent and predictable experience, reinforcing the celebrity’s brand.

Engaging with the Audience

Engaging with the Audience

Engagement is a two-way street in social media. For celebrities, it’s not just about posting content, but also about interacting with their followers. Responding to comments, participating in discussions, and acknowledging fan posts can significantly enhance engagement levels.

This interaction makes followers feel valued and heard, fostering a sense of community. Additionally, celebrities can engage their audience through live sessions, Q&As, and by sharing user-generated content, making their social media presence more interactive and lively.

Strategic Content Planning

Successful social media management for celebrities requires strategic content planning. This involves determining the right mix of personal, promotional, and professional content.

While fans appreciate glimpses into their personal lives, it’s also important to balance this with content related to their professional projects or endorsements. Planning content also involves timing; understanding when the audience is most active and scheduling posts accordingly can increase visibility and engagement.

Leveraging Visual Storytelling

Leveraging Visual Storytelling

In today’s social media landscape, visual content plays a pivotal role. Celebrities can leverage visual storytelling through high-quality images, videos, and infographics to capture the audience’s attention.

This visual content should not only be aesthetically pleasing but also tell a story that resonates with the audience. Whether it’s behind-the-scenes footage, lifestyle shots, or creative collaborations, visual content can significantly enhance the appeal and shareability of posts.

Managing Online Reputation

Social media is a double-edged sword; while it offers immense opportunities for branding, it also poses risks to a celebrity’s reputation. Proactive online reputation management is crucial.

This includes monitoring social media for mentions, addressing negative comments constructively, and being cautious about the content that is shared. Celebrities should also be aware of the impact of their words and actions on social media, as they can quickly become viral and subject to public scrutiny.

Continuous Learning and Adaptation

Continuous Learning and Adaptation

The social media landscape is constantly evolving, with new platforms, trends, and algorithms emerging regularly. For celebrities, staying informed and adapting to these changes is essential to maintain relevance.

This might involve exploring new platforms, experimenting with different content formats, or adopting the latest social media trends. Continuous learning and adaptation are key to keeping the audience engaged and interested.

Balancing Personal and Professional Content

A crucial aspect of a celebrity’s social media strategy is the balance between personal and professional content. This balance helps in humanizing the celebrity while maintaining their professional image.

Sharing personal life moments, such as hobbies, interests, or family photos, allows fans to connect on a more personal level. However, it’s equally important to promote their work, whether it be film releases, music albums, brand endorsements, or appearances.

The key is to find a harmonious blend that doesn’t overwhelm followers with too much of either. This balance keeps the content diverse and engaging, encouraging followers to stay tuned for a mix of insights into the celebrity’s personal life and professional endeavors.

Utilizing Analytics for Insight

Understanding the impact of social media activities is vital. Analytics tools available on platforms like Instagram, Twitter, and Facebook provide valuable insights into follower demographics, engagement rates, and content performance.

Celebrities and their management teams can use this data to refine their strategies, tailor content to their audience’s preferences, and identify the best times to post.

Analytics can reveal what type of content resonates most with the audience, helping to shape future content strategies. Regular review of these metrics ensures that the social media approach remains data-driven and aligned with audience preferences.

Dealing with Criticism and Controversy

Navigating criticism and controversy is an inevitable part of a celebrity’s social media journey. It’s essential to handle such situations with grace and professionalism. Ignoring negative feedback is not always the best approach; sometimes, addressing concerns or criticisms head-on can demonstrate accountability and sincerity.

However, it’s crucial to differentiate between constructive criticism and trolling or harassment. In cases of the latter, setting boundaries and sometimes taking legal action may be necessary. How celebrities handle controversy can significantly impact their public image and follower loyalty.

Building a Community Around Your Brand on Social Media

Social media offers an opportunity for celebrities to build a community around their brand. This community is not just a follower base but a network of supporters and enthusiasts who resonate with the celebrity’s persona and values.

Fostering this sense of community can be achieved by creating exclusive content for social media followers, organizing meet-and-greets, contests, or giveaways, and supporting causes important to the community. A strong, engaged community can be a powerful asset, providing support and amplifying the celebrity’s voice on various platforms.
